What is an Advertising Driver job?

An Advertising Driver is responsible for driving a vehicle that displays advertisements, such as a wrapped car, billboard truck, or digital screen vehicle. Their job is to increase brand visibility by following designated routes or parking in high-traffic areas. Some positions require personal vehicle use, while others provide company-owned vehicles. Compensation may be based on mileage, hours driven, or a flat rate per campaign.

What are the typical responsibilities of an Advertising Driver during a standard workweek?

As an Advertising Driver, your main duties include operating specially branded vehicles or those equipped with mobile billboards along designated routes to maximize ad exposure. You may be responsible for maintaining the vehicle's cleanliness and appearance, tracking mileage and routes covered, and occasionally interacting with the public to answer basic promotional questions. Some employers also require drivers to report on campaign progress by taking photos or logging trip details using a mobile app. This role generally involves working independently but may require coordination with advertising teams or supervisors to adjust routes and schedules. Can I get paid to put advertising on my car?

Advertising drivers are paid to display advertisements on their vehicles, often through contracts with marketing companies or brands. Payment varies based on factors like driving distance, location, and campaign duration, and drivers typically need to have a clean driving record and meet vehicle requirements.

Founded in 1902, Lamar Advertising Company is one of the largest outdoor advertising companies in the world. With over 351,000 displays across the United States and Canada, Lamar is dedicated to helping both local businesses and national brands reach broad audiences every day.
